The Problem
A student group can have a strong itinerary and still face a rough first hour overseas. Airport Wi-Fi may not be available when needed. Students may be split across arrivals. A leader may need to send a time-sensitive update. Students without data can miss a meeting point or rely on a parent to troubleshoot from another country.
The operational issue begins before the plane takes off. If connectivity is introduced late, participants must compare plans, decide how much data they need, check handset compatibility, and figure out activation on their own. Program staff then inherit scattered questions in the final days before departure. That is a poor use of the team’s time, especially when they are already handling packing, documentation, rooming, and emergency information.
Traditional physical SIM distribution creates another handoff. Cards must be ordered, received, matched to travelers, packed, distributed, and installed. For a group operator, each handoff is another chance for delay. A digital eSIM changes that sequence. CELITECH describes a post-checkout flow in which travelers receive a branded QR code to scan and are online when the trip begins.
The checklist also needs an owner. If no one is accountable for collecting device eligibility, issuing activation instructions, and directing support questions, the program can advertise connectivity without making it usable. The goal is not to add another checklist item for its own sake. The goal is to ensure students can connect at the moment the program needs them to.
How the Solution Works
Start with the program’s existing traveler workflow. When participants confirm a trip, collect the destination, travel dates, and number of travelers. Those inputs match the variables CELITECH says its programmable eSIMs can adjust: destination, start and end dates, data amount, and number of eSIMs.
Next, choose how connectivity appears in the journey. A tour operator can place it in a booking or confirmation flow, bundle it with the program package, or send participants to a branded landing page. The right choice depends on how your program collects participant payments and distributes pre-departure materials. Keep the message direct: this is the data service students should set up before travel.
Once a participant has access to the plan, the activation experience is short. The participant receives a branded QR code, scans it on an eSIM-enabled device, and follows the installation steps. Include the QR-code instruction in the same pre-departure email or portal where students find their itinerary and travel documents. Ask them to complete installation while they still have dependable internet access at home.
Then prepare the student for arrival. Tell them when the plan starts, how to turn on the eSIM line and cellular data, and whom to contact if setup does not work. Make the first task practical: after landing, connect, check the group message, and navigate to the meeting point. This helps turn an abstract service into a concrete part of the arrival plan.

Implementation
Use a short rollout sequence with named owners.
-
Program operations owns the travel inputs. Confirm destinations, trip dates, traveler count, and the planned data allowance. These details should align with the participant roster and itinerary.
-
The digital or product owner chooses the delivery point. Decide whether the eSIM is bundled, offered in the confirmation journey, or sent through a branded landing page. CELITECH offers integration options for these models and describes API and SDK support for embedding connectivity in digital experiences.
-
The technology team handles integration. CELITECH states that travel providers can launch branded connectivity in days, with no setup fees or CAPEX. Confirm the selected integration method, test the participant-facing flow, and make sure the brand and trip details are correct before the first group receives it.
-
Participant communications owns the checklist. Send a single message that includes device eligibility guidance, the activation link or QR code, installation steps, start-date expectations, and the support route. Repeat the reminder a few days before departure.
-
Program leaders own the arrival playbook. Give leaders the same setup instructions and a short troubleshooting path. They should know where the group’s first message, meeting location, and emergency contacts live, so students can use data the minute they arrive.
Before launch, run a small internal test with an eSIM-enabled phone. Check the QR-code delivery, installation instructions, activation timing, and support handoff. Then add connectivity to the standard pre-departure checklist alongside passports, visas, airline information, and emergency contacts.
